A New WayTo Easily Share Your Home Movies (NAPSA)—Thanksto a clever breakthrough, your old home movies now have a new home. A service has been designed to provide friends and families scattered across the country with an easy way to share their home videos, by sending them directly to the television. How It Works It works like this: Rather than burning and mailing DVDs or viewing videos on a computer, friends and family will now be able to set up their own private channel to send home videos directly to a TiVo subscriber’s TV set. TiVo has partnered with One True Media, an online service that helps people turn their video and photos into stylish digital video montages, to create a comprehen- sive, end-to-end solution for creating these videos and sharing them with whomeverhe or she chooses. After uploading their home movies and photos to One True Media, consumers can quickly make a video montage complete with soundtrack and special effects. Next, they will receive a personal TiVo channel code that they can distribute to other TiVo subscribers. With a few clicks of their TiVo remote, friends and family can get a Season Pass recording that automatically delivers all current and future home movies from the videocreator. Your Home Movie On TV—Home movies can now be sent over the Internet directly to television sets. Videos will be displayed in TiVo subscribers’ Now Playing List— the same location where they access all of their favorite television recordings. A Nice Way To Share Memories To share home movies or slide showsprivately, the video creator gives his personal TiVo channel code to friends and family. Only people with the unique personal code can see the published channel. Thus, creators can share their videos with friends and family, while ensuring that their most treasured memories are not publicly available. To learn more, visit tivo.com/ homemovies.
